Founded in 1994, T2 Systems is a leading provider of parking management software solutions. The company offers a comprehensive suite of services, including permit management, event parking, vehicle counting, and citation processing. T2 Systems serves a diverse clientele, ranging from municipalities to private organizations, aiming to streamline parking operations and enhance user experience through technology. How much funding has T2 Systems raised?

T2 Systems has raised a total of $31M across 2 funding rounds:

Other Financing Round (2007): $3M with participation from Petra Capital Partners

Private Equity (2011): $28M led by Pamlico Capital
